Gaku IGARASHI(イガラシ ガク)Associate Professor

Gaku IGARASHI

Associate Professor
Department of Economics:Statistics

Brief personal history

2010: Graduated from Department of Economics, Faculty of Economics and Business Administration, Hokkaido University
2015: Obtained Ph.D. (Economics) from Graduate School of Economics and Business Administration, Hokkaido University
2015: Assistant Professor, Department of Policy and Planning Sciences, Faculty of Engineering, Information and Systems, University of Tsukuba
2021: Associate Professor, Faculty of Economics, Gakushuin University

Main results

(Papers)
"Re-formulation of inverse Gaussian, reciprocal inverse Gaussian, and Birnbaum─Saunders kernel estimators" (with Kakizawa, Y.), Statistics and Probability Letters, Vol.84, pp. 235-246, 2014.
"On improving convergence rate of Bernstein polynomial density estimator" (with Kakizawa, Y.), Journal of Nonparametric Statistics, Vol.26, Issue 1, pp.61-84, 2014.
"Bias corrections for some asymmetric kernel estimators" (with Kakizawa, Y.), Journal of Statistical Planning and Inference, Vol.159, pp. 37-63, 2015.
"Bias reductions for beta kernel estimation", Journal of Nonparametric Statistics, Vol.28, Issue 1, pp.1-30, 2016.
"Weighted log-normal kernel density estimation", Communications in Statistics-Theory and Methods, Vol.45, pp. 6670-6687, 2016.
"Inverse gamma kernel density estimation for nonnegative data" (with Kakizawa, Y.), Journal of the Korean Statistical Society, Vol.46, Issue 2, pp. 194-207, 2017.
"Generalized gamma kernel density estimation for nonnegative data and its bias reduction" (with Kakizawa, Y.), Journal of Nonparametric Statistics, Vol.30, Issue 3, pp. 598-639, 2018.
"Multivariate density estimation using a multivariate weighted log-normal kernel", Sankhya A, Vol.80, Issue 2, pp.247-266, 2018.
"Limiting bias-reduced Amoroso kernel density estimators for non-negative data" (with Kakizawa, Y.), Communications in Statistics-Theory and Methods, Vol.47, Issue 20, pp. 4905-4937, 2018.
"Multiplicative bias correction for asymmetric kernel density estimators revisited" (with Kakizawa, Y.), Computational Statistics and Data Analysis, Vol.141, pp.40-61, 2020.
"Nonparametric direct density ratio estimation using beta kernel", Statistics, Vol.54, Issue 2, pp.257-280, 2020.

Message

When you want to assert something, the data and statistical analysis that support that claim provide important evidence to make it more convincing. Currently, because statistical analysis software is so good, it seems that once you learn how to use the software, you can perform statistical analysis easily. However, statistical analysis is built under a unique concept based on probability and logic, and it is not simple to determine which statistical analysis method to use for data and how to interpret statistical analysis results. In recent years, there has been a proliferation of data and tables and graphs based upon them, but without correct statistical knowledge, there is a danger they will be misinterpreted.
